Kinetics IsoMax Clip Provides a Space-Saving Acoustic Solution for Headingley Hall Care Home

Report this content

CMS Acoustics, the UK’s largest provider of acoustic solutions, has specified and supplied its Kinetics IsoMax Clip system for a new build extension at Headingley Hall Care Home in Leeds. Exceeding Part E standards, Kinetics IsoMax Clips are designed to completely isolate walls and ceilings, providing resilient isolation of sound and a space-saving acoustic solution. Constructed using a special rubber isolator, the Kinetics IsoMax Clip system outperforms standard resilient bar systems, achieving an additional sound insulation of up to 7dB and a load bearing capacity of 22.5kg per clip. At Headingley Hall, the challenge was to install a product that would maximise sound insulation with minimal impact on space. Based on the low profile design and high performance credentials of Kinetics IsoMax Clip, CMS Acoustics recommended the system as the ideal solution. After consultation with CMS Acoustics, W.A Brownes, specialists in drywall installation and manufacturing, installed the clips over a total area of 1700m2. Requiring only standard materials for installation, the Kinetics IsoMax Clip system was quick and easy to install and provided superior noise control. Sean O’Brien, site supervisor of W.A Browne, commented: “CMS Acoustics provided technical support at the start of the project, which subsequently ensured an efficient onsite installation. The clips were the obvious choice as the project objectives were to exceed Part E building regulations with minimal impact on living space.” The Kinetics IsoMax Clips can be attached to ceiling joists, timber and metal studs or masonry. The design of the system reduces the risk of error at installation stage, as screws cannot be inadvertently attached to the stud or joist through the resilient area.
